Point out the direction of the current if any induced to flow in the coil by the changing magnetic field. (Depicted is a view of the coil from the side. Toward the top of the display in the diagram is upward.)
Answer:
The key to putting Lenz's Law is figuring out what change in the magnetic field through the coil is occurring and establishing what direction a new magnetic field would have to be in to fight that change. At this time we have an up-through-the-coil magnetic field which is increasing. To fight that raise we need a down-through-the-coil magnetic field. Therefore Bpin the magnetic field produced by the induced current, must be down-through-the-coil.
Now we have to enquire our self in what direction must the current flow around in the coil in order to produce a downward-through-the-coil directed magnetic field. The magnetic field is the direct thing in this problem so we point our right thumb in the down-through-the-coil direction and note that our fingers then curl around in the clockwise as viewed from above direction.
